Verdict
RTX A6000 has 24 GB more VRAM, making it better suited for large models and long context windows. For compute-bound workloads like training, RTX A6000 delivers 2.2× higher FP16 throughput.
Specifications
| A10G | RTX A6000 | |
|---|---|---|
| VRAM | 24 GB | 48 GB |
| VRAM Type | GDDR6 | GDDR6 |
| Memory Bandwidth | 0.6 TB/s | 0.8 TB/s |
| FP16 Performance | 36 TFLOPS | 77 TFLOPS |
| Manufacturer | NVIDIA | NVIDIA |
| FP8 Support | No | No |
| FP4 Support | No | No |
Price / Performance
Based on cheapest single-GPU on-demand pricing. Lower $/TFLOP = better compute value; lower $/GB = better memory value.
| A10G | RTX A6000 | |
|---|---|---|
| $/hr (cheapest) | $1.01✓ best | $1.09 |
| $/TFLOP (compute value) | $0.0283 | $0.0141✓ best |
| $/GB VRAM (memory value) | $0.0419 | $0.0227✓ best |
